Automatic For The People: Myths And MSME Day 2021

On 27th June we celebrate the UN’s Micro, Small and Medium sized Enterprises (MSME) Day. According to data provided by the International Council for Small Business (ICSB), MSMEs make up over 90% of all firms and account, on average, for 70% of total employment and 50% of GDP. They are the heart of our economies and our communities, providing employment and much needed services. ...

Penang Bay Ideas: An Exciting Social Win For SDG Zones

The Penang State Government recently announced the top prize winners of the Penang Bay International Ideas Competition. Launched in August 2020, the competition was designed to invite innovative ideas from around the world to transform the Penang Bay area into a Sustainable Development Goals (SDG) compliant city zone and economic area. ...
